Pineapple Soft Serve Ice Cream
Preparation Time:
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Freezing Time: 2 hours
- Total Time: 2 hours 15 minutes
Difficulty Level:
- Easy
Ingredients:
- 4 cups frozen pineapple chunks
- 1/2 cup coconut milk (or any milk of choice)
- 2 tbsp honey or agave syrup (optional, for added sweetness)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- Fresh mint leaves (for garnish, optional)
Instructions:
- Prepare the Pineapple:
- If not using pre-frozen pineapple chunks, cut a fresh pineapple into chunks and freeze them for at least 2 hours or until completely frozen.
- Blend the Ingredients:
- In a high-speed blender or food processor, combine the frozen pineapple chunks, coconut milk, honey or agave syrup (if using), and vanilla extract.
- Blend until smooth and creamy, stopping to scrape down the sides as needed. This may take a few minutes depending on your blender’s power.
- Adjust Consistency:
- If the mixture is too thick, add a little more coconut milk, 1 tablespoon at a time, until the desired consistency is reached.
- Serve Immediately:
- Scoop the pineapple soft serve into bowls or cones.
- Garnish with fresh mint leaves if desired.
- Optional Freezing:
- For a firmer texture, transfer the soft serve to an airtight container and freeze for an additional 30 minutes to 1 hour before serving.
